作 者:冯建国[1]
机构地区:[1]河北省水利水电勘测设计研究院,天津300250
出 处:《资源环境与工程》2017年第4期475-479,共5页Resources Environment & Engineering
摘 要:为解决南水北调中线工程填筑土料严重不足问题,拟采用中细砂改性技术方案。根据南水北调中线京石段应急供水工程S3、S12、S19标段中细砂改性室内试验成果,总结分析改性土的物理力学指标与掺加材料、试验龄期之间的相关关系,为工程设计进行方案比选提供必要的物理力学参数。In order to solve the serious shortage of filling soil in the middle route of South to North Water Transfer Project,the medium fine sand modification technology was adopted. According to the results of laboratory test on modification of medium fine sand of S3,S12,S19 tenders in emergency water supply project of Beijing Shijiazhuang section in middle route of South to North Water Transfer Project,the correlation between physical mechanical indexes and materials,test ages of modified soil are summarized and analyzed,the necessary physical and mechanical parameters are provided for scheme comparison for engineering design.
